JUDGMENT
The petitioner had preferred this writ petition, challenging the order dated 24.08.2020, which was passed by respondent No. 2, by virtue of which the petitioner, who was representing as Pradhan Gram Panchayat, Aamwala Vikas Khand Sahaspur, as a consequence of being elected in the election, held as for the said post, has been removed by the respondents while exercising powers under Section 138 (1) (ga) of the Punchayat Raj Act, 2016.
2. In fact, if the reasons, which are assigned in the impugned order, are taken into consideration for disentitling the petitioner to continue to enjoy the elected office of Pradhan, was on the ground that the high school certificate or the qualification certificate, which she possessed and which constituted as to be the basis of her candidature to contest the election, was subsequently complained of, to have been found to have been procured by fraud.
